Overview

The Tianfeng LS-25000W Air-Cooled Circulating Chiller is an integrated, high-stability thermal management system engineered for continuous-duty laboratory and industrial applications requiring precise, reliable coolant temperature control. Unlike water-cooled chillers that depend on external cooling towers or facility water loops, this unit employs a closed-loop air-cooled condensing system—making it ideal for laboratories with limited infrastructure, mobile setups, or environments where water supply or drainage is constrained. Its core thermodynamic architecture utilizes a scroll compressor paired with high-efficiency copper-aluminum finned condensers and optimized refrigerant circuitry (R410A or R407C, compliant with current EU F-Gas regulations), delivering stable 25 kW nominal cooling capacity at standard conditions (chilled water inlet 12 °C, outlet 7 °C; ambient intake 30 °C, exhaust ≤40 °C). The chiller maintains setpoint accuracy within ±0.1 °C across its operational range of 0–10 °C—critical for instrumentation demanding minimal thermal drift, such as graphite furnace atomic absorption spectrometers (GFAAS), inductively coupled plasma optical emission spectrometers (ICP-OES), and transmission electron microscopes (TEM).

Key Features

  • Integrated air-cooled design eliminates dependency on facility water lines or cooling towers—reducing installation complexity and total cost of ownership.
  • Precision digital PID temperature controller with real-time LED display of actual and setpoint temperatures; optional RKC controller available for enhanced repeatability and programmable ramp/soak profiles.
  • Full stainless-steel reservoir (200 L) and circulation pump—resistant to corrosion from deionized water, glycol-water mixtures, or mild chemical coolants commonly used in analytical instrumentation.
  • High-reliability scroll compressor with integrated overheat, overcurrent, and high/low pressure safety interlocks—ensuring robust operation under variable load conditions typical of laser systems or vacuum pumps.
  • Adjustable flow rate (0–60 L/min) and pressure (0–2.0 bar) via calibrated bypass valve and variable-speed pump driver—enabling compatibility with instruments having diverse hydraulic resistance requirements.
  • Low-noise acoustic enclosure (<65 dB(A) at 1 m) suitable for placement within shared laboratory spaces without violating occupational noise exposure limits (OSHA/NIOSH guidelines).
  • Comprehensive electrical architecture using certified components from Siemens, Schneider Electric, and Omron—supporting long-term reliability and compliance with IEC 61000-6-2/6-4 EMC standards.

Software & Data Management

The base unit operates via embedded firmware with local control only; however, the optional RKC controller provides RS-485 Modbus RTU or Ethernet TCP/IP communication interfaces. This enables remote monitoring and setpoint adjustment through third-party SCADA systems (e.g., Ignition, WinCC, LabVIEW) or custom Python/Node-RED scripts. Logged data—including real-time temperature, flow rate, compressor run time, and fault codes—is timestamped and exportable in CSV format. When deployed in multi-instrument cooling networks, units can be daisy-chained for centralized supervision. All firmware updates are performed via secure USB flash drive—no internet connectivity required—preserving network isolation integrity in secure research facilities.

Applications

  • Materials Characterization: Stabilizing detector cooling stages in XRF and XRD systems to minimize thermal noise and improve peak resolution.
  • Atomic Spectroscopy: Maintaining constant graphite tube temperature during GFAAS atomization cycles to ensure reproducible calibration curves (per ASTM D5174, ISO 11885).
  • Electron Microscopy: Regulating specimen stage and lens coil temperatures in TEM/SEM to suppress thermal drift during high-magnification imaging (>100k×).
  • Laser Systems: Managing diode-pumped solid-state (DPSS) and fiber laser head temperatures to sustain wavelength stability and beam pointing accuracy.
  • Vacuum & Thin-Film Deposition: Cooling diffusion pumps and ion sources in sputtering and evaporation systems to prevent oil backstreaming and maintain base pressure integrity.
  • Pharmaceutical Process Support: Providing controlled coolant to jacketed reactors during lyophilization cycle development or fermentation temperature profiling (aligned with USP analytical instrument qualification).

FAQ

What is the maximum recommended return water temperature for continuous operation?
The unit is designed for chilled water return temperatures ≤40 °C. Sustained return temperatures above this threshold increase compressor discharge pressure and reduce volumetric efficiency—potentially triggering high-pressure cutout. For optimal service life, maintain return water ≤35 °C.

Can this chiller operate with 30% ethylene glycol/water mixture?
Yes—the stainless-steel reservoir, pump, and internal heat exchanger are compatible with glycol concentrations up to 40%. Note that glycol reduces effective cooling capacity by ~8–12% and increases fluid viscosity; adjust flow rate accordingly to maintain Reynolds number >2300 for turbulent flow in connected instrumentation.

Is remote alarm output available for integration into building management systems?
Standard units include dry-contact fault relay outputs (compressor fault, high temp, low flow). Optional analog 4–20 mA or Modbus signals are available with the RKC controller upgrade.

Does the chiller meet environmental refrigerant regulations for export to the EU or UK?
Yes—it uses R410A or R407C refrigerants, both listed under the EU F-Gas Regulation (No. 517/2014) with GWP values below the phase-down thresholds applicable to commercial chillers in its capacity class.

What maintenance intervals are recommended for laboratory-grade operation?
Inspect air filters monthly; clean condenser coils quarterly using compressed air or low-pressure water. Verify refrigerant charge and compressor oil level annually via certified technician. Log all interventions in accordance with ISO/IEC 17025 clause 8.9 for accredited testing laboratories.
